Discovering Hove's Unique Party Venues: A Guide to Coastal Celebrations
When planning a corporate celebration or professional gathering in Hove, the coastal setting offers a unique opportunity to create an event with both sophistication and charm. As you embark on discovering party venues in this seaside town, consider how the local Regency architecture can add an air of elegance to your occasion. High ceilings and expansive windows not only enhance the ambiance but also allow natural light to complement your chosen decor.
For a truly memorable experience, leverage Hove's picturesque beachfront by selecting venues that offer stunning sea views. This natural backdrop is perfect for evening events where the sunset can provide a breathtaking start to the festivities. When considering entertainment, tap into Hove's vibrant cultural scene by hiring local bands or entertainers who can bring a touch of Brighton's eclectic music vibe.
Accessibility is key for ensuring all guests can attend without hassle. Check transport links such as proximity to Hove station and available parking facilities—details that are crucial for those travelling from afar. Additionally, embrace eco-friendly practices by working with venues that prioritise sustainability; this could include waste reduction initiatives or energy-efficient lighting systems.

Creating the Perfect Ambiance: Decor, Music, and Entertainment in Hove
Creating the perfect ambiance for a party in Hove requires a keen eye for detail and an understanding of the local culture. Begin by considering decor that complements Hove's elegant Regency architecture and coastal charm. Utilise soft, warm lighting to highlight the high ceilings and large windows typical of venues in this area, creating an inviting atmosphere as guests arrive.
Music sets the tone for any event, so curate a playlist that resonates with your theme while also reflecting Hove's seaside spirit. Consider hiring local bands or DJs who can infuse your party with genres ranging from jazz to modern indie, all while giving a nod to Brighton's rich musical heritage. Live entertainment options abound; from magicians who add a touch of whimsy to classical quartets that bring sophistication, ensure they align with your venue's acoustics.
Interactive elements like photo booths or bespoke cocktail stations can keep guests engaged throughout the evening. For those looking to incorporate technology into their event, explore options such as light projections on walls or ceilings that can transform spaces with captivating visual displays.
Remember, creating an unforgettable experience in Hove isn't just about aesthetics; it's about crafting moments that resonate long after the last dance. By blending thoughtful decor choices with locally-sourced music and entertainment tailored to your audience, you'll set the stage for a truly exceptional celebration.
Catering and Libations: Sourcing Local Delights for Your Hove Event
When it comes to catering and libations for your Hove event, sourcing local delights not only supports the community but also provides guests with a taste of the area's culinary heritage. Hove's proximity to the sea means that fresh seafood is a must-have on your menu. Collaborate with local caterers who specialise in dishes like succulent crab canapés or smoked mackerel pate, ensuring that ingredients are sourced sustainably and seasonally.
For beverages, consider featuring craft beers from Sussex breweries or spirits from nearby distilleries to add an authentic touch. A signature cocktail crafted with local gin can become a talking point among attendees. Don't forget non-alcoholic options too; artisanal sodas and mocktails using regional flavours will cater to all preferences.
In planning your event's catering aspects, remember practicalities such as ensuring there are enough service staff for smooth delivery and checking dietary requirements in advance. This attention to detail will be appreciated by guests and reflects well on your organisation.

Ensuring a Smooth Soiree: Accessibility, Safety, and Eco-Friendly Practices
Ensuring a smooth soiree in Hove involves meticulous planning, particularly when it comes to accessibility, safety, and eco-friendly practices. For professionals organising events at medium to large organisations, these considerations are not just about convenience but also about demonstrating corporate responsibility.
Firstly, ensure your chosen party venue is accessible for all guests. This includes checking for step-free access, availability of lifts for multi-storey venues, and accessible toilets. It's also worth considering the proximity to Hove station or bus routes for those relying on public transport; providing clear directions in your invitations can help guests plan their journey with ease.
Safety is paramount; conduct a thorough risk assessment of the venue beforehand and establish clear signage for emergency exits and assembly points. If you're expecting a large number of attendees, consider hiring professional security staff to maintain order.
Embracing eco-friendly practices can significantly enhance your event's reputation. Opt for digital invitations over paper ones to reduce waste and work with venues that offer recycling facilities. Encourage caterers to use locally sourced ingredients and avoid single-use plastics where possible.
By focusing on these key areas—accessibility, safety, and sustainability—you'll not only ensure a seamless experience but also contribute positively towards Hove's community ethos. Beyond the Bash: Post-Event Activities and Gathering Feedback in Hove
Once the last toast has been made and the music fades at your Hove party venue, consider extending the experience with post-event activities that capture the essence of this coastal town. A leisurely brunch at a seafront cafe offers guests a relaxed setting to reflect on the night's festivities while enjoying Hove's culinary offerings. Alternatively, organise a group stroll along the promenade or arrange for a private tour of local landmarks like Hove Museum & Art Gallery to enrich your guests' cultural experience.
Gathering feedback is crucial for honing future events. Create a short, engaging survey that can be easily accessed via smartphone—include questions about venue facilities, catering quality, and overall enjoyment. Offer an incentive for completion such as entry into a prize draw or discounts on future events to encourage participation.
For corporate event planners, consider leveraging LinkedIn polls or creating dedicated email follow-ups to gather professional insights. This not only provides valuable data but also helps maintain business relationships post-event.
Remember to share highlights from your event on social media platforms using custom hashtags; this not only serves as immediate feedback but also promotes your organisation's flair for hosting memorable occasions in Hove. By thoughtfully planning post-event activities and efficiently gathering attendee feedback, you ensure that each celebration leaves a lasting impression and continues to resonate with all who attended.
